There are many numbers that satisfy the first condition. The numbers beginning with 6 are discarded. It means the number on the cards must begin with 5 or 7.
The second condition is more specific. To find the numbers on the cards that are divisible by 6 take into account that for a number to be divisible by 6, it needs to be divisible by 2 (the last digit must be a pair digit) and by 3 (the sum of its digits must be a multiple of 3). Remember that we already know that the number must begin with 5 or 7.
Make a list:
510
522
504
516
528
720
702
714
726
708
The smallest number from the numbers that begin with 5 is 504 and from the numbers that begin with 7 is 702. Start adding 6 to each number until you have obtained a number more than 599 and 799 respectively.
504
510
516
522
528
534
540
546
552
558
564
570
576
582
588
594
702
708
714
720
726
732
738
744
750
756
762
768
774
780
786
792
798
Now, count them.
There are 33 cards with a number that meets these conditions.